Abstract
The utility model relates to the technical field of electronic products, and provides a quick startup system of an intelligent interactive all-in-one machine, aiming at reducing the startup time of a user waiting for the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ine, which comprises the following steps: the main control module is respectively in signal connection with the large screen module, the OPS computer module and the key module, a first system is arranged in the main control module, the main control module further comprises a light sensing module used for detecting external light, the main control module controls the starting of the first system according to a detection signal of the light sensing module, and the large screen module and the OPS computer module are controlled to be started according to a key signal of the key module on the premise that the first system is started and completed. By adopting the structure, the starting time of the user waiting for the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ine is reduced, and the use experience of the user is improved.

Background
The intelligent interactive all-in-one machine is intelligent interactive equipment integrating touch, display, a computer, sound equipment and the like into one whole machine, and is provided with an android and Windows double system. The intelligent interactive all-in-one machine adopts large-screen liquid crystal display, has good man-machine interaction performance and convenient installation and operation, and is widely applied to the fields of teaching, meetings and the like at present.
The multifunctional highly-integrated interactive intelligent all-in-one machine gradually becomes a necessary product in the fields of teaching, meetings and the like, but due to the design of the Andriod and Windows dual systems, the starting time can consume dozens of seconds or even minutes every time, the teaching and meeting time is greatly occupied, the teaching and meeting efficiency is seriously influenced, and the user experience is poor.

Detailed Description
In order to make the objects, technical solutions and advantages of the present invention more apparent, the present invention is further described in detail with reference to the following embodiments. It should be understood that the specific embodiments described herein are merely illustrative of the utility model and are not intended to limit the utility model.
As shown in fig. 1, the system for rapidly booting an intelligent interactive all-in-one machine includes: the main control module is respectively in signal connection with the large screen module, the OPS computer module and the key module, a first system is arranged in the main control module, the main control module further comprises a light sensing module used for detecting external light, the main control module controls the starting of the first system according to a detection signal of the light sensing module, and the large screen module and the OPS computer module are controlled to be started according to a key signal of the key module on the premise that the first system is started and completed.
Specifically, the large screen module comprises a display screen and a backlight system, and the backlight system is used for providing a light source for the display screen. The key module is used for carrying out on-off operation on the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ine and comprises an integrated key or a remote control key. The first system is an Andriod system. The OPS computer module is internally provided with a second system which is a Windows operating system.
As shown in fig. 2, when a user is about to start a meeting or a teaching, generally, a curtain is opened, a light is turned on, and the like, which causes light changes in a meeting room and a classroom, the light sensing module powered by a standby power supply monitors light changes in the external environment in real time in the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ine in a standby state, when the light changes from dark to bright, the light sensing module outputs a light sensing signal to the main control module, the main control module receives the light sensing signal, the standby CPU starts timing, and when the light sensing signal is maintained for a certain time, the standby CPU starts waking up the Andriod system (including boot loader starting, real-time operating system Kernel starting, system Framework starting, desktop Launcher starting, and the like, and loading and completing related service programs), but does not light the large screen module. And if the light sensation signal is not maintained for enough time, no response is made, and the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ine is still in the standby mode. The light sensing signal can be a signal with different voltage values, a high-low level signal, a digital pulse signal, and the like.
On the premise of starting the android system, after the main control module receives a key signal sent by a user, the display screen and the backlight system are quickly and sequentially lightened, the OPS computer module is opened, and the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ine enters a normal working state; if the main control module does not receive the key signal sent by the user all the time, the state of only waking up the Andriod system is always kept, and whether the signal from the light sensing module changes or not is detected in real time.
When the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ine is in the state of only awakening the Andriod system, when the external light changes from bright to dark, the Andriod system is automatically closed, and the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ine automatically enters the standby state again.
According to the scheme, whether the user possibly uses the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ine is judged according to the external light condition, if yes, an android system is awakened in advance, and when the user uses the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ine, only the OPS computer module and the large screen module need to be awakened through the key module, so that the starting waiting time of the intelligent interactive all-in-one machine is shortened, and the use experience of the user is improved.
